<code dir="aoav"></code><style dropzone="hxxb"></style><sub id="hibv"></sub>
<u date-time="ufh"></u><em dir="1lr"></em><area dir="9yn"></area><del id="0f9"></del><area draggable="lqr"></area><var lang="or7"></var><abbr dropzone="c0h"></abbr><ins lang="j50"></ins>

实时账本:tpwallet余额更新的全栈协同解法

开头:在一家连锁咖啡店试点中,tpwallet如何在用户付款后实时更新余额,保证商户和用户账面一致?本文以案例研究方式,分层解析从前端支付到区块链最终确认的全流程,并探讨实时支付接口、区块链协议、数据共享与智能监控如何协同实现高效、安全的余额更新。

流程概述:用户在收银端发起支付请求→前端调用tpwallet实时支付API(REST+WebSocket)提交签名交易并获得临时回执→钱包节点将交易广播至区块链或Layer2支付通道→利用轻客户端或Merkle Proof快速验证交易上链状态→当达到预设确认数,节点触发异步Webhook或SSE推送回商户与用户终端→本地账本执行幂等写入并返回最终余额。

技术细节:实时支付接口采用短连接(REST)用于交易提交、长连接(WebSocket/SSE)用于状态流;API设计支持幂等ID、重放保护与断点续传。区块链协议层支持主链结算与Layer2闪电通道,兼顾速度与最终性;数据共享使用加密的JSON-LD或Protobuf格式,通过TLS与密钥管理保证隐私与可审计性。节点间同步采用事件溯源,保证异步场景下的一致性与可回溯性。

智能化处理与监控:在数据流入端,流处理引擎(如Kafka+Flink)做实时ETL、聚合与异常检测;机器学习模型识别异常消费模式、重复支付或双花风险;告警系统结合自愈策略(暂挂、回滚、人工审核)确保资金安全。监控指标包括端到端延迟、确认数分布、失败率与余额漂移,所有事件写入不可篡改的审计链以便事后核查。

高效支付技术实践:采用预授权、余额缓存与乐观并发控制提升响应体验;在高并发场景通过分片账本和本地锁定减少冲突;跨平台数据同步采用幂等事件与补偿事务保障最终一致性。对于商户侧,优先显示“临时可用余额”并在链上最终确认后更新“最终可用余额”,兼顾体验与安全。

案例结果:试点阶段,采用Layer2+Merkle快速校验后,平均支付确认延迟从22秒降至3秒,余额错配率降至0.01%,异常自动拦截率提升40%,顾客结账满意度显著提高。实践表明,余额更新不是单一接口或链上操作,而是API设计、链下协同、智能数据处理与监控体系的系统工程。

结语:通过分层架构与智能化策略,tpwallet在保证区块链最终性与审计性的同时,实现了用户感知的即时余额更新。未来,将更多依赖可组合的实时API、跨链结算与更精细的异常模型,进一步把科技化生活方式https://www.mdjlrfdc.com ,的支付体验落实到每一次交易中。

作者:李安辰发布时间:2025-09-25 18:15:22

相关阅读